Unraveling the AI Transformation: US-China Influence Manoeuvres and Global Digital Regulation

The escalating competition between the United States and China for primacy in artificial intelligence is fundamentally reshaping global digital policy. Governments worldwide are scrambling to navigate the complex implications of increasingly powerful AI systems, from national security threats to the future of work and ethical implications. While the US focuses on fostering innovation through a somewhat hands-off approach, coupled with export limitations to hinder China’s advancements, Beijing is aggressively investing in AI research and development, often with a government-directed planning mechanism. This divergence generates a challenging landscape for international collaboration, demanding a reassessment of how AI is developed and implemented on a global basis, ultimately impacting economic growth and geopolitical equilibrium.

Exploring Beyond Human Intelligence: Predicting the Trajectory of Superintelligent AI

The foreseen arrival of superintelligent systems presents a profound challenge to humanity, demanding a careful evaluation of its possible course. While pinpointing a precise progression remains elusive, several emerging pathways are conceivable. Some researchers propose a gradual advancement, where AI capabilities steadily surpass human intelligence across specialized domains, ultimately converging into a generalized superintelligence. Alternatively, a more unexpected "intelligence explosion" is contemplated, where recursive self-improvement leads to an unprecedented leap in capabilities, fundamentally altering the environment beyond our existing comprehension. Additional complicating issues are the volatile influences of computational advances, algorithmic findings, and the moral considerations shaping AI development. Therefore, predicting the precise trajectory of superintelligent AI requires a holistic approach, acknowledging both the scientific possibilities and the societal ramifications.
